1 Euro is Equal to How Many Pounds?

The euro (€) and the pound (£) are two of the most widely used currencies in the world. The euro is the official currency of the European Union, while the pound is the official currency of the United Kingdom. If you're planning a trip to Europe or the UK, it's essential to know the exchange rate between these two currencies.

Exchange Rate: 1 Euro to Pound

The exchange rate between the euro and the pound can fluctuate constantly due to various economic and political factors. However, as of the current date, the approximate exchange rate is:

1 EUR = 0.84 GBP

This means that if you exchange 1 euro, you'll get approximately 0.84 pounds. Conversely, if you exchange 1 pound, you'll get approximately 1.19 euros.

Tips for Exchange

When exchanging euros to pounds or vice versa, keep the following tips in mind:

Use a Reliable Currency Converter

  • Use a reputable online currency converter or a currency exchange service to get the latest exchange rate.

Avoid Airport Exchange Offices

  • Airport exchange offices often charge higher fees and offer less competitive exchange rates.

Use an ATM or Debit Card

  • Withdrawing cash from an ATM or using a debit card can be a convenient and cost-effective way to exchange currencies.
